
Born 1963 in Düsseldorf. After studying Theatre and Philosophy at Munich and Vienna she worked in various theatres. From 1990 to 1996 she was a director and resident author at the Theater der Jugend in Vienna. Since 1995 she and Corinne Eckenstein jointly head the Theater Foxfire in the Austrian capital, where she also lives. She has received several prizes for her plays.
Prizes and Awards
- Dinslaken Kathrin Türcks Prize 1988 - for "Leben eben"
- Baden-Württemberg Authors Prize 1990 - for "Leben eben"
- Dinslaken Kathrin Türcks Prize 1994 - for "Gestohlenes Meer"
- North Rhine-Westphalia Drama Prize for Women Artists 1997
- An Award in the 3rd German-Dutch Competition for Authors of Theatre for Children and Young People - for "Verhüten und Verfärben"
- Nominated for the German Youth Theatre Prize 2002 with "Verhüten und Verfärben
